Rimac electrified the luxury and exclusivity of Monterey Car Week.
Rimac quickly rose to stardom on the hypercar landscape by being a pioneer in electric performance engineering, creating hypercars capable of unprecedented speed, acceleration, and track performance. After merging with Bugatti, however, Rimac undeniably cemented its place in the canon of automotive history, and its presence at this year’s Monterey Car Week was a celebration of the incredible achievements the brand has earned recently.
The new Rimac Nevera R was on display, the even more intense version of the Nevera with 2,107 all-electric horsepower and 24 new performance records set earlier this year. In addition, cars like the Rimac Nevera and the Rimac Nevera Time Attack were seen driving around the stunning hills and coastline roads throughout the Monterey Peninsula area throughout Car Week.
The Rimac Nevera R and different Rimac customer cars were present at a party hosted at a stunning private residence in Monterey, with VIP guests and Bugatti Rimac executives present. With a growing lineup and an expanding legacy of electric hypercar performance excellence, Rimac’s presence at Monterey Car Week this year was a celebration of the brand’s approach to the future of performance.
